Face recognition and face detection are two terms that are often used interchangeably, but they are actually two distinct technologies with different capabilities. In this blog post, we will discuss the key differences between face recognition and face detection.
Face Detection
Face detection is the technology that can locate and recognize human faces within a digital image or video. It is the first step in facial recognition systems. Face detection systems can identify the presence of a human face in an image or video, regardless of the person's identity.
Face detection systems work by identifying certain facial features, such as the eyes, nose, and mouth. These features are used to create a template that can be used to match against other faces. Face detection systems can be used for a variety of purposes, such as:
- Unblurring faces in photos.
- Detecting faces in security footage.
- Unlocking smartphones or tablets.
Face Recognition
Face recognition is the technology that can identify an individual based on their facial features. It is a more complex technology than face detection, and it requires a database of known faces to compare against.
Face recognition systems work by creating a mathematical representation of a person's face. This representation is then compared against the representations of faces in a database. If a match is found, the system can identify the person.
Face recognition systems can be used for a variety of purposes, such as:
- Access control.
- Law enforcement.
- Social media.
Key Differences
The key difference between face detection and face recognition is that face detection can only identify the presence of a face, while face recognition can identify an individual based on their face.
Find a table that summarizes the key differences between face detection and face recognition here: Face Recognition vs. Face Detection: Understanding the Key Differences